Transaction 2b13937332cc71aee51141fd75c0a88ed7f6d248fe01256a24249a7d8315c660
2 Input
2 Outputs
- 2b13937332cc71aee51141fd75c0a88ed7f6d248fe01256a24249a7d8315c660:0
- 2b13937332cc71aee51141fd75c0a88ed7f6d248fe01256a24249a7d8315c660:1
value 25009008253
address 1KwA4fS4uVuCNjCtMivE7m5ATbv93UZg8V
value 50000
address 1Q8UGseuajhWVXpSH64btba1YkHEqdG67P